"It doesn't help to have the law on your side. You also have to reckon with the judiciary," the well-known cabaret artist Wolfgang Hildebrandt once said with a moderate amount of joy. Who would know that better than we in Karlsruhe - it has been the seat of the Federal Court of Justice and the Federal Constitutional Court here since 1951. So it seems only logical that we also offer a tour of Karlsruhe's legal history, including general information on the legal system, constitution and tasks of the Karlsruhe courts.
